The Role We Want You For
The Senior Project Engineer – Steel Procurement is an advanced, on-site leadership role responsible for overseeing and executing steel procurement logistics, delivery coordination, and material verification across complex or large-scale projects. This position works closely with the Project Manager and Senior Project Manager while serving as a primary on-site authority for steel delivery sequencing, fabrication coordination, and issue resolution.
In addition to performing core Project Engineer responsibilities, the Senior Project Engineer provides mentorship to Project Engineers, leads field-level coordination efforts, proactively resolves complex delivery and fabrication issues, and ensures steel procurement activities align with project schedules, budgets, and quality standards. This role is a critical link between CDC project management, fabrication shops, dispatch teams, and site operations.
The Specifics of the Role
- Lead daily and weekly steel delivery coordination with Project Managers, Senior Project Managers, fabricators, dispatch teams, and site leadership.
- Oversee fabrication and delivery schedules to ensure alignment with project sequencing, erection plans, and field constraints.
- Proactively identify schedule risks, delivery conflicts, or fabrication issues and drive timely resolution.
- Serve as the primary escalation point for steel delivery, logistics, and material sequencing challenges on site.
- Oversee and perform check-in of all delivered steel materials to verify accuracy, quantity, condition, and completeness against: Bills of lading, shop drawings, shipping lists, project requirements.
- Lead resolution efforts for missing, damaged, or incorrect materials, coordinating corrective actions with PM/Sr. PM, fabricators, dispatch, and field teams.
- Maintain and audit delivery logs, material tracking records, and discrepancy documentation to ensure accuracy and traceability.
- Coordinate directly with fabrication shops regarding material readiness, shipping sequences, production status, and corrective fabrication.
- Conduct and lead fabrication shop visits as required to verify readiness, sequencing, and quality.
- Support PMs and SPMs with documentation for change orders, back charges, and corrective fabrication related to steel procurement issues.
- Serve as the CDC on-site lead coordinating between:
- Project Manager / Senior Project Manager
- Steel fabricator
- Dispatch and logistics teams
- Field supervision and erection crews
- Participate in and lead steel-related site meetings focused on sequencing, deliveries, and installation planning.
- Support field teams by clarifying material locations, delivery timing, installation priorities, and resolution paths for steel-related issues.
- Mentor and guide Project Engineers on delivery coordination, material verification, and documentation best practices.
- Support continuous improvement initiatives related to logistics planning, delivery sequencing, material tracking, and site coordination.
- Contribute to the development and refinement of CDC steel procurement field procedures and standards.
